We came in to the same problem this morning.  What we ended up doing was 
restoring from a backed up ldif file.  Once we had it partially working, 
another fix came out and broke it again.

Ryan Golhar wrote:

>This morning, I came in to work and was told no one could log on to any
>of the linux machines.  After some digging, I checked the LDAP directory
>and found out it was totally empty -- it was overwritten.
>
>I was able to recreate it based on /etc/passwd and /etc/shadow, but then
>proceeded to find out why.  I found out that last night, new ldap rpms
>were installed by up2date:
>
>[Thu Sep  2 00:32:14 2004] up2date installing packages:
>['nss_ldap-207-11', 'openldap-2.0.27-15', 'openldap-clients-2.0.27-15',
>'openldap-servers-2.0.27-15']
>[Thu Sep  2 00:32:27 2004] up2date Removing packages from package
>profile: ['nss_ldap-207-10', 'openldap-2.0.27-11',
>'openldap-clients-2.0.27-11', 'openldap-servers-2.0.27-11']
>[Thu Sep  2 00:32:28 2004] up2date Adding packages to package profile:
>['nss_ldap-207-11', 'openldap-2.0.27-15', 'openldap-clients-2.0.27-15',
>'openldap-servers-2.0.27-15']

>I've now marked ldap to be skipped in updates, but am curious if this is
>normal behaviour. 
>
>Thank god I keep everything in /etc/passwd and /etc/shadow just in case.
